The Cat Doctor in Indianapolis, IN

Find The Cat Doctor in Indianapolis,Marion County,IN to get information on Veterinary Care, Pet Grooming, Pet Boarding, Pet Supplies, Pet Insurance, and Pet Adoption Services
The Cat Doctor
5654 Georgetown Road, Indianapolis, IN 46254
317-291-2287
Mon-Fri 7:30 AM-6:00 PM,Sat 8:00 AM-12:00 PM

Nearby Animal Hospital

Social Service Offices in Indianapolis

Browse by City

Sorry, there is no content available